summaryrefslogtreecommitdiffstats
path: root/net/ipv4/proc.c
diff options
context:
space:
mode:
authorIlpo Järvinen2007-08-25 07:54:44 +0200
committerDavid S. Miller2007-10-11 01:48:29 +0200
commit5b3c98821a8753239aefc1c217409aa3e5c90787 (patch)
tree39d4d2bc47ad533cd084a900fa94542ef1b6e8bf /net/ipv4/proc.c
parent[TCP]: Rename tcp_ack_packets_out -> tcp_rearm_rto (diff)
downloadkernel-qcow2-linux-5b3c98821a8753239aefc1c217409aa3e5c90787.tar.gz
kernel-qcow2-linux-5b3c98821a8753239aefc1c217409aa3e5c90787.tar.xz
kernel-qcow2-linux-5b3c98821a8753239aefc1c217409aa3e5c90787.zip
[TCP]: Discard fuzzy SACK blocks
SACK processing code has been a sort of russian roulette as no validation of SACK blocks is previously attempted. Besides, it is not very clear what all kinds of broken SACK blocks really mean (e.g., one that has start and end sequence numbers reversed). So now close the roulette once and for all. Signed-off-by: Ilpo Järvinen <ilpo.jarvinen@helsinki.fi> Signed-off-by: David S. Miller <davem@davemloft.net>
Diffstat (limited to 'net/ipv4/proc.c')
0 files changed, 0 insertions, 0 deletions